Man Found Shot to Death Inside Northwest Jacksonville Home; Sheriff’s Office Detains Several People for Questioning

Early-morning shooting investigated in Moncrief area
A man in his mid-20s was found shot to death inside a home early Monday in Northwest Jacksonville, and several people were detained as detectives worked to determine what led up to the killing, the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office said.
Officers were dispatched at about 2:30 a.m. Monday, Jan. 26, 2026, after a report of a shooting inside a residence on Boilard Drive near New Kings Road. When police arrived, they located the victim inside the home with at least one gunshot wound. He was pronounced dead at the scene.
What investigators say they know so far
Detectives described the case as an active investigation and said they are still working to establish the circumstances that preceded the shooting, including the nature of any relationship among the people involved.
Police said multiple people were detained for questioning as the investigation continued. No arrests were immediately announced, and the Sheriff’s Office did not release the victim’s name Monday morning.

What remains unknown at this stage
Investigators have not publicly detailed whether the shooting occurred during a dispute, whether the victim knew the shooter, or whether a weapon has been recovered. Police also have not released information on how many people were detained or what prompted the initial call beyond a reported shooting inside the home.
